The role of Associate Banker is key within Chase’s Consumer & Community Banking division. This division provides banking services including personal banking, credit cards, mortgages, auto financing, investment advice, small business loans, and payment processing. The Consumer Banking group focuses on managing personal money through checking, savings, and credit card products combined with the latest banking technology. The team is recognized for leading U.S. credit card sales and deposit growth while receiving top marks in customer satisfaction. As an Associate Banker, you will represent Chase’s brand and culture by delivering exceptional hospitality and client service. Using cutting-edge financial technology alongside friendly and knowledgeable assistance, you will engage customers by greeting them, managing lobby traffic, and scheduling appointments.

Your responsibilities will include opening and servicing accounts with full compliance of regulatory and bank policies, educating clients on banking technology like the Chase Mobile App and ATMs, and building meaningful relationships by listening actively and sharing product knowledge to help customers meet their financial goals. The Associate Banker will also perform essential branch operations including managing cash devices such as the cash vault and ATM systems. The role requires a detail-oriented approach to banking processes while focusing on elevating the client experience through collaboration and genuine care.

Job Duties

  • Create a welcoming environment by delivering attentive and friendly service by greeting clients as they enter the branch, making them feel heard and cared for, leveraging a tablet to manage lobby traffic, check clients into the waiting queue, and schedule/cancel client meetings
  • Exceed client expectations by providing account servicing and maintenance as well as opening new accounts, while complying with all policies, procedures, and regulatory and banking requirements
  • Educate and assist clients with day-to-day banking transactions including the usage of technology self-service options such as leveraging the Chase Mobile App, Chase.com, and ATMs can help them with their banking needs whenever, wherever, and however they want
  • Build meaningful relationships with clients by actively listening, asking thoughtful questions, demonstrating empathy, and sharing product knowledge and solutions – partnering with other branch team members to help achieve their financial goals
  • Perform branch operations, which may include managing cash devices such as the cash vault, ATM, or others while adhering to all bank policies and procedures
